Boeing Defense, Space and Security (BDS) has an exciting opportunity for an Associate Product Review Engineer to support the Aerospace Composites Center (ACC) in Hazelwood, MO.
The selected Product Review Engineer will apply knowledge of design principals to assess and resolve product/process issues through the product lifecycle.
Position Responsibilities:
Researches and builds knowledge of Boeing and engineering design principles in order to develop solutions to product/process issues for production or simple technical in-service issues.
Assists with analyses, root cause analysis and drafting dispositions for design non-conformances.
Assists system owner in preparation of technical communications. Identifies analyses fleet data, collects and evaluates data on customer findings for product/process improvement opportunities that may include recurrent product support issues.
Supports activities to identify deviations that could impact design intent and safety.
Participates in Material Review Boards and Integrated Product Teams (IPTs).
Assists with the design of interim structural repairs to restore damaged structure to original design strength capability.
